Buku Canton, 23rd April, The office of the Standard Oil Co. of New Terkin Shamaasisi zeceipt of a blackmailing. fatter: from; robban,in which they demand a Large sum of money. The robbers threaten to burn the Company's oil tanks, should the money demanded be not forthcoming The matier has been reported to the local authorities through the United States Consulʼat Canton,"

The captain of the vessel was quick to perceive the nefurious design and at once raised an alarm, which was answered by a guard boat in the vicinity. Fortunately, a patrolling launch, was also near at hand, with whose ansistance also The daring plot was nipped in the bud.. The sold ers of the guard boat, together with 18830,988,000 the crew of the Aong Wal, had a vigorous... hand-to-band fight with the pirates with the result that the pilot of the Awang Wat was killed and several others wounded. Ultimately, the soldiers were able to secure the arcent of some twenty of the robbers, who have now been brought
Chaton to be dealt with..

HOUSE COLLAPSE.
At 5 p.m. yesterday two buildings in Luen Street collapsed without warning. Five per- sons were seriously wounded and twenty-seven others slightly injured. The members of the Red Cross Society on learning of the accident at once proceeded to the sceneto render assist- ance and have now the iojared under their care.

MILITARY OFFICER LXÉCUTED,
By order of the Viceroy a miktary officer samed Husg Chiu Kin was executed yesterday to the presence of the Provincial judge, for the crime of manslaughter..

As shown above, the production of yarn is the country has advanced from 4 million kin to reatly 300 million in during the last twenty years. Especially remarkabla has been the Advance in the axpart during the same paied. The import of coston yarn, on the other hand, has been steadily diminishing, and what is now imported belongs to the qualities which are act produced in Japan. *, **

Reviewing the development of the cotton spinning and weaving industry.in Japan, còn. inusi the Tokyo Journal, it will be noted that it owes its progress purely to its own merits, as uo outside protection or, encouragemant worth mentioning has been accorded. Moreover, the industry bai had to contend against foreign, goods which are admitted into the country at the exceptionally low Conventional tariffs. Fur ther, the Japanese spinner must get their sup. ply of raw cotton from distant countries across the sea, nad spinning and weaving machinery has had to be imported. Despite these dis advantageous circumstances the industry has made great advance and achieved phenomenal success- circumstance which speaks much- for the industrial capabilities of the people. FIRE IN A $110. Yesterday, a fire broke out in Yan, Căsi Street in a certain shop, where a large quantity of combustible articles war stored. The out break occurred, quite close to the Cantos Medical College. The fire. brigades, stationed AL-various places quickly turned out on the alarm being given and put down the con Bagration in a short space of time. The build ing where the fire, originated gas-completely gutted, and nina persone ware more or less. lojured.
THE NEW CITY, OF KRUNGCHOW. It is ascertained that the new city of Heung- chow, has been granted special privileges. whereby the inhabitants are exempt from taxta on imports and exports. No barriers, will be created in the city itself but stations will-be established where necessary, le collect taxes. or goods" wberrig transit to the interior

BUREAU OF FOREIGN AFFAIRS, As Taotai Im Ku, formerly in charge of the Bureau of Foreign Affilis attached to the Canton Viceroyalty, left here.an transfer to Fukien as Inspector of Finance, H E, Viceroy Chang Jen.chun bas for some time been look lag for a competent official to fill the vacancy. H.E. has now secured-the-services of Toots! Wong to act in place of Thotai Im Ku. It is reported that Tantal Work will shortly pro coed to the South to take up the past. ****
